ad-free

Channel / Source: secureteam10
Title: Alaska River Monster Found? Green UFO Blasts Over Japan! 11/1/16
Published: 2016-11-02
Source: https://www.youtube.com/watch?v=gw0WF8djpRM

TITLE:
Alaska River Monster Found? Green UFO Blasts Over Japan! ...

SECTION: